QR codes have evolved into a powerful strategy for bridging offline engagement with online action. For metal fabricating machinery suppliers, they provide an effective tool for streamlining lead capture, enhancing distributor relationships, and enabling instant access to machinery information and support resources, all without additional apps or complex processes.

With suppliers under pressure to deliver value-added experiences and ensure seamless procurement and service workflows, QR codes connect printed catalogs, trade show displays, demo equipment, and technical documentation to rich digital journeys. Many early physical interactions are missed when anonymous show-floor visitors or hands-on evaluators never fill out a demo form and never make it into the supplier’s CRM, resulting in lost opportunities. Linking physical equipment touchpoints to online content, spec sheets, or live chat unlocks measurable growth and ensures every potential lead is tracked, nurtured, and not lost to competitors.

This article explains how metal fabricating machinery suppliers can leverage QR codes to improve engagement, capture buyer intent, and centralize valuable offline data by integrating these solutions at every stage of the customer lifecycle.

Why QR Codes Matter for Metal Fabricating Machinery Suppliers

Image

The sales and support cycle for industrial machinery still depends heavily on face-to-face meetings, printed catalogs, and business cards, which creates friction and a lack of visibility. A potential buyer can review reference materials or observe a demo without providing contact details, leaving sales teams blind to qualified demand. QR codes in marketing solve these issues by converting passive interest into immediate, trackable digital action.

QR codes are particularly effective because they require no app downloads and remove the need to type long URLs. A single scan can open videos, spec sheets, calculators, or live chat. For suppliers that maintain constantly evolving product lines and compliance documents, dynamic QR codes ensure that a printed label or brochure always points to up-to-date content, even after assets are in the field.

  • Bridge offline to online: Put QR codes on print ads, trade show signage, operator panels, and equipment nameplates to deliver spec sheets, digital catalogs, and configurators on demand.
  • Enable speed and simplicity: Provide instant access to demo scheduling, virtual factory tours, and distributor contacts, reducing friction for buyers and partners who are ready to act.
  • Keep content current: Update destinations behind printed codes as models change, certifications are renewed, or new pricing becomes available without reprinting collateral.
  • Gain trackability: Track how, when, and where prospects scan each asset to capture intent signals such as product interest, region, and buying stage.
  • Drive cost efficiency: Use low-cost QR deployments to scale across catalogs, crates, invoices, and plant signage with measurable conversions and attribution.

Consider familiar moments in this industry. A business card QR code can add the rep to the buyer’s contacts and open a saved brochure. A nameplate on a press brake can link to warranty registration, safety checklists, and spare parts ordering. These small changes create a shared language between offline equipment and online journeys that sales, marketing, and service teams can finally measure.

Common QR Code Formats for Metal Fabricating Machinery Suppliers

Different QR formats align to distinct business needs. Choosing the right format for each use case ensures scanners land on experiences that drive action and contribute reliable data for attribution. Suppliers building channel relationships and configuring complex machinery benefit most from formats that capture context and reduce steps for the user.

Web links, form-driven destinations, and vCards are the most common choices in this vertical, followed by Wi-Fi and app downloads in specific scenarios such as training and connected maintenance. Dynamic codes are especially powerful because they allow you to manage destinations centrally, update content post-print, and segment by placement without changing the printed asset.

  • Web links: Lead scanners to product pages, selector tools, comparison charts, or quote forms so each scan becomes a trackable digital session.
  • vCards: Let distributors and buyers instantly save a rep’s contact details with role-based routing, while giving suppliers visibility into relationship growth and field handoffs.
  • Forms: Capture buyer requirements, demo requests, service tickets, or warranty registrations at the moment of interest with pre-filled fields based on context or event.
  • [SMS or email](https://tap.sqr.me/blog/unlock-customer-engagement-qr-codes-for-text-messages): Pre-populate a message to sales or service with the machine ID and error code, enabling rapid triage without requiring a phone call.
  • Wi-Fi access: Offer secure event or facility network access to visitors, then guide them to a content hub or agenda so engagement begins right away.
  • App downloads: Direct users to maintenance, training, or AR visualization apps and auto-detect device type so they land on the right store page.

Use static codes when pointing to unchanging, low-stakes resources such as a PDF manual. Use dynamic codes when you need tracking, flexible destinations, and segmentation. Step-by-Step QR Campaign Execution Checklist

A structured approach prevents underperforming deployments and helps teams move quickly from pilot to scale. Use this checklist to plan and launch campaigns with clarity, then iterate based on what you learn. Each step emphasizes aligning QR placements with a tangible business outcome and making data actionable.

Before you start, map the buyer journey and list the offline assets that prospects and customers already encounter. For each asset, define a single, valuable action that scanning should enable. Design codes and destinations that respect the scanning environment, such as factory floors and busy exhibition halls.

Step 1: Choose the Use Case

Define a clear objective for each code so success is easy to measure. Decide whether you are driving net-new leads, accelerating open opportunities, or improving post-sale experiences. Examples include demo booking on a new fiber laser, spec download for a press brake series, or service request submission for installed machines.

  • Clarify the goal: Decide if the scan should book a meeting, capture requirements, deliver training, or register a product, then shape the destination accordingly.
  • Identify the audience: Tailor destinations by persona, such as process engineers, plant managers, or distributor reps, so the value is obvious at first tap.
  • Prioritize high-impact assets: Start with show-floor signage, hero brochure pages, and equipment labels that see the most interaction.

Step 2: Pick the QR Code Type

Choose static when the destination will not change and data does not matter. Choose dynamic when you want full tracking, the ability to edit destinations after printing, and campaign-level management across many placements. For service and sales flows, dynamic codes are recommended.

  • Match format to action: Use web links for content and tools, forms for capture and service, vCards for relationship building, and SMS or email for quick triage.
  • Plan for scalability: Use dynamic codes in Sona QR when assets will be reused across regions, events, or SKUs so you can manage variations without new print runs.
  • Add parameters: Append UTMs to destinations to retain source and medium data in your analytics stack.

Step 3: Design and Test

Make codes scannable in real-world conditions. Use sufficient size, high contrast, and quiet zones. Surround the code with a bold frame and an explicit CTA that signals the benefit and expected action. Test with common devices across lighting conditions and distances.

  • Brand and frame: Add your logo and colors subtly, then include a benefit-led CTA such as Scan to configure or Scan for maintenance schedule.
  • Size and contrast: Increase size for distance scanning on booth walls and use matte finishes to reduce glare on glossy brochures or metal plates.
  • Field testing: Validate scans on iOS and Android, at angles, and in low light. Confirm that UX and forms are mobile friendly and fast.

Step 4: Deploy Across High-Impact Channels

Roll out in phases. Start with flagship events and flagship machines, then extend to distributors, service vans, and packaging as you gather results. Keep a central index of all codes, placements, and destinations so teams can coordinate updates.

  • Match placement to behavior: Put demo booking codes near machines, spec download codes on brochures, and support codes on operator panels where problems arise.
  • Equip your field: Give reps talking points, show them where codes live, and arm them with QR-enabled handouts that accelerate conversations.
  • Unify creative: Maintain consistent frames, icons, and CTA language so users learn what to expect from your codes.

Step 5: Track and Optimize

Monitor scan volume, conversion rates, and downstream actions. Compare performance across placements, models, and events. Use insights to refine CTAs, content, and code locations. Feed signals to your CRM and ad platforms for remarketing and sales prioritization.

  • Instrument analytics: Use Sona QR to view scans by location, time, and device, and to analyze which placements drive engagement and conversion.
  • A/B test experiences: Experiment with different CTAs, page layouts, and form lengths to improve completion rates.
  • Close the loop: Attribute revenue to scans with Sona, then scale the placements and messages that generate pipeline and accelerate deals.

Tracking and Analytics: From Scan to Revenue

Image

Many suppliers struggle to connect QR activity to revenue outcomes. Counted scans are useful, yet insufficient, because they do not reveal how interactions influenced the buying journey. You need to understand whether a scan drove a demo request, advanced an opportunity, or helped close a sale. That level of clarity requires integrated tracking and multi-touch attribution.

Treat every code as a campaign asset. Use UTMs for source and medium, tag codes by placement and model, and send scan events to your analytics, CRM, and attribution tools. This allows you to build dashboards that map scans to form fills, meetings, quotes, and purchase orders.

  • Capture complete scan data: Track time, device, location, destination, and referring asset to understand context and intent.
  • Measure engagement by placement: Compare booth wall scans versus machine-mounted labels, catalog inserts versus postcards, and use these insights to reallocate spending.
  • Attribute downstream actions: Link scans to demos, RFQs, and purchases using CRM campaign influence or Sona’s multi-touch models to prove impact.
  • Sync with your systems: Enrich leads and contacts in HubSpot or Salesforce with scan metadata so sales can prioritize and personalize outreach, and see Sona–HubSpot integration for a walkthrough.
  • Connect the buyer journey: Use Sona’s Buyer Journeys to stitch QR scans together with website visits, email opens, ad clicks, and meeting bookings for a full-funnel view.

With full-funnel attribution, every QR code becomes a measurable revenue asset. You can identify which models and messages drive the most interest, which events justify expansion, and which after-sale experiences reduce churn risk.

Expert Tips and Common Pitfalls

Scaling QR effectively requires both technical rigor and change management. The technology is simple, yet success depends on context, content quality, and the discipline to iterate. Avoid trying to make one code do everything. Instead, deploy multiple codes that each map to a single high-value journey and measure the outcomes separately.

Common pitfalls include placing codes where scanning is unsafe or impractical, pointing to slow or outdated destinations, and failing to instrument analytics. Another frequent mistake is omitting a clear CTA or hiding codes in dense layouts. Treat QR codes as first-class UI elements in your physical and print design.

  • Design for the environment: Use durable materials, high-contrast frames, and larger sizes for long-distance scans. Test in low light and on textured surfaces common in shops.
  • Focus each code on one action: Choose a single goal per code such as Book a demo or Download the manual to reduce decision friction and improve completion rates.
  • Maintain dynamic destinations: Keep links updated and responsive. Rotate in fresh case studies, pricing updates, or safety notices without reprinting assets.
  • Train teams and set expectations: Provide talking points and workflows for reps and booth staff. Include benefit-forward CTAs so scanners know exactly what they will get.
